English adjective: controversial | |||
| 1. | controversial marked by or capable of arousing controversy | ||
| Samples | The issue of the death penalty is highly controversial. Rushdie's controversial book. A controversial decision on affirmative action. | ||
| Similar | arguable, contentious, debatable, disputable, disputed, moot, polemic, polemical | ||
| Antonyms | noncontroversial, uncontroversial | ||
